Join the MICA Master’s program and help shape the food of tomorrow!

This unique master’s program, entirely focused on food, will allow you to develop your creativity to design new food products, while strengthening your skills in product development and formulation.

You will gain a solid mastery of laboratory techniques, as well as an understanding of food marketing challenges and consumer expectations.

The MICA Master’s program trains you to turn an idea into a tangible product, integrating food regulations and packaging considerations from the very start of the design process.

A comprehensive program to become a leader in food innovation.

The main objective of this master's degree is to train managers capable of innovating and addressing the multiple facets of food quality.

Master curriculum

 


An inter-institutional and multi-campus program

The Master’s in Food Innovation and Design Management is offered as a joint degree between

  • the University of Liège: Gembloux Agro-Bio Tech, Faculties of Veterinary Medicine and Medicine;
  • the Charlemagne University of Applied Sciences: Technical and Agronomic Departments.
  • Classes are held primarily in Gembloux and Liège:  

    in Gembloux: on the Gembloux Agro-Bio Tech (ULiège) and Charlemagne Agro (HECh) campuses

    in Liège: on the Sart Tilman campus 

    One course is held in Huy, on the Charlemagne Agro (HECh) campus.

    The program is organized to minimize travel between campuses as much as possible.

    Career Opportunities
    The skills developed during this master’s program provide access to advisory, consulting, and project management roles in the agri-food sector (manufacturing, SMEs and micro-enterprises, mass retail, etc.).
    They provide the ideal profile forleading innovation within a food company.
